Official School Records

1. Student Information System (SIS)

Most schools utilize Student Information Systems (SIS) to manage student data, including names. SISs are databases that store essential information about students, such as contact details, academic records, and enrollment status. If you have access to the SIS, you can retrieve student names by searching the database using criteria such as grade level, class, or birthdate.

School Directory

2. School Website

Many schools publish student directories on their websites for easy access. These directories typically list students’ names, contact information, and grade levels. However, it’s important to note that not all schools maintain online directories due to privacy concerns.

Classroom Rosters

3. Teacher’s Records

Teachers typically maintain classroom rosters, either physically or electronically, with student names and contact information. If you need to find a student’s name, contacting their teacher directly can provide you with the necessary information.

Physical Documents

4. Physical Attendance Records

In schools that still use traditional physical attendance records, you can find student names by checking the attendance sheets. These records are usually kept in the school office or with the homeroom teacher.

Privacy Considerations

It’s important to handle student information with care and adhere to privacy laws and regulations. Before accessing student names, ensure that you have the necessary authorization and permissions. Always use the information responsibly and refrain from sharing it with unauthorized individuals.
